Bug 15009 - Planning dropdown button in aqbudget can have empty line
authorBlou <philippe.blouin@inlibro.com>
Tue, 13 Oct 2015 20:12:49 +0000 (16:12 -0400)
committerKyle M Hall <kyle@bywatersolutions.com>
Fri, 29 Apr 2016 12:59:16 +0000 (12:59 +0000)
commitb8076d8ec7236360274e1a4e861969c86bb679ea
tree671a456946bcb99e7a5344c76dd73b80805735af
parentb4ce86df28ce937ea06b8f31010bf4cd85755c52
Bug 15009 - Planning dropdown button in aqbudget can have empty line

When displaying a budget, the Planning button in the admin toolbar displays

Plan by months
Plan by libraries
Plan by item types
Plan by

The last one is empty, due to C4::Budgets::GetBudgetAuthCats returning an empty field if the budget has no sort defined.
This prevents returning an array with empty element(s)

TEST:
1) Admin -> Budgets
2) Select a budget
   a) you must have '' (empty) in your aqbudgets.sort1_authcat field.
   b) edit the budget (direct DB or interface) to get that.
3) Click on Planning dropdown, see the "Plan by <nothing> " entry.
4) apply the patch, revalidate.

Signed-off-by: Bernardo Gonzalez Kriegel <bgkriegel@gmail.com>
No more empty option
No errors

Signed-off-by: Jonathan Druart <jonathan.druart@bugs.koha-community.org>
Signed-off-by: Kyle M Hall <kyle@bywatersolutions.com>
C4/Budgets.pm